A Historical overview
Morocco’s winemaking heritage dates back over two thousand years, with evidence indicating that the Phoenicians and later the Romans cultivated grapes and produced wine in this region of north Africa. However, with the rise of Islam in the seventh century, winemaking faced significant challenges due to religious restrictions. During the French colonial period in the 20th century, wine production resumed and expanded, although it remained relatively modest compared to other wine-producing countries.
As for beer, it was introduced by the French during their colonial rule, and modern beer brewing began to take shape in the early 20th century. Over time, beer consumption gained popularity among locals and tourists alike, leading to a growing demand for various beer styles.
Revolutionizing Moroccan Wine
In recent decades, Moroccan winemakers have embarked on a mission to redefine the country’s wine identity. Embracing modern viticultural techniques, they have cultivated international grape varieties such as Cabernet Sauvignon, Merlot, Syrah, and Chardonnay, alongside indigenous varietals like Cinsault and Moroccan Grey. The diverse geography of Morocco, with its coastal plains, mountains, and desert oases, offers a range of microclimates, contributing to the unique territory that influences the character of the wines.
Notable wine regions in Morocco include:
Casablanca Valley: A coastal region characterized by a Mediterranean climate, producing crisp white wines.
Meknes: The region surrounding the historic city of Meknes, known for producing elegant reds and aromatic whites.
Beni-M’Tir: Located in the foothills of the Atlas Mountains, this region is famous for its bold red wines.
Moroccan wines have garnered attention for their impressive quality. The delicate balance of fruitiness, spice, and herbal notes reflects the country’s unique cultural blend.
The renaissance of craft beer in Morocco
In conjunction with the growth of the wine industry, a thriving craft beer movement has emerged in Morocco. Local business owners and brewers have embraced experimenting with flavors, styles, and ingredients in response to worldwide craft beer trends.
Thanks to the growth of microbreweries and brewpubs, craft beer communities are blossoming in cities like Casablanca, Marrakech, and Tangier. Moroccan craft brewers are well known for using regional elements into their beers, such as fresh herbs, fruits, and spices, to create distinctive and intriguing brews.
